Teams looking to dump $7 million in salary to avoid the luxury tax are finding a suitor in Utah. The Jazz, who are $7 million under the cap, at $37 million, are actively looking to take on a $7 million player for picks and cash. "They either want a one-year guy or they'll take on someone with a longer deal - if they feel he's special and can help their team go forward," said one Western Conference executive who has talked to the Jazz. Incidentally, Utah has only $12 million in salaries committed for next season....
